WebTop up with cold water. Add vegetables and bouquet garni. Bring to a simmer again but do not let the stock boil vigorously. Regulate the heat so that a few bubbles rise to the surface. Skim regularly and keep the ingredients covered by topping up with cold water. Cook uncovered for 3-4 hours. Web8 Jul 2024 · Age of lay: 5 months. Eggs/week: 3-6. Eggs/year: 150-300 (depends on the strain) Leghorn chickens are one of the best egg producers available. Some Leghorns will even lay through the winter, although usually at a lower rate. Egg production, however, will vary depending on the variety and strain of chicken.
